  12. I don't throw real heavy swimbaits, 2 oz max. mostly Mattlures hard bluegills...My rig is a shimano 7'6" calcutta, reel is shimano Chronarch 101...I use either 12, or 10 lb Yozuri Hybrid ultrasoft. If your tossin heavier baits, I'd bump the test up accordingly, also depends on structure too.

  14. Today I was fishin my rage toads with a 5/0 1/8 oz keel hook. The bite was nada so I startin practicing my casting, heaven knows I need it..lol Anyway, this was on my spinning rig...so , I sidearm a very low cast, about 2 1/2' off the water, low n behold, I skippeg my toad 3 times, and it went about 4-5 ' just guessin on the distance. Also I tried different retrives, slow, fast and whippin the rod..make for some great action on the toads. Also rigged my rt lizard up that way too..like it better than a bullet weight t rigged.
